Visual Arts

Preparation in the visual arts provides our young women with creative and critical problem-solving skills in addition to developing their own appreciation of art as a unique visual record of the diverse cultures of the world. The Visual Arts take a holistic orientation to education. Our curriculum is designed to challenge McAuley's young women to:

  • engage to the imagination.
  • foster flexible ways of thinking creatively and critically.
  • develop disciplined effort.
  • build self-confidence.
  • achieve technical skills for personal expression.
  • build portfolios for future study and career opportunities.
  • compete and exhibit their original artwork.

Our art students participate in many private and public-sponsored competitions. They also enter into many exhibitions throughout the South Chicago Metropolitan area, Illinois and Midwest region, including the Art ConnectED Senior Scholarship competition and exhibition, IAEA Northerner Regional Art Exhibition,  Midwest Regional Scholastic Art & Writing Awards. The Art Program sponsors the Annual Juried Art Exhibition/Artapalooza and a senior Franklin Framing Gallery in Blue Island.

Art students participate in Memory Project

For over 10 years, Mother McAuley Art Students have participated in the Memory Project, which invites high school students to create heartfelt portraits of children living in orphanages around the world.  AP Art & Design and Studio Honors students created this year's portraits that were recently delivered to children in India.

Mother McAuley is one of the top 20 Illinois Art Education Associations scholarship schools.

In the Spring of 2020 our Advanced Placement Art & Design students received $1,700,000.00 in scholarship offers.
In the Spring of 2022 our Advanced Placement Art & Design students received $3,987,718.00 in scholarship offers.
